What is Cognitive VR?

Cognitive VR provides older adults with engaging, research-backed activities that simulate real-life scenarios to support mental sharpness and independence.

These exercises are designed to challenge memory, improve problem-solving skills, and boost confidence in performing everyday tasks.

Innovative Features That Make a Difference

Simulated Activities of Daily Living (ADLs)

Participants can engage in immersive experiences like:

  • Grocery shopping.
  • Navigating a city.
  • Organising a room.
  • Getting dressed.

Group and Individual Experiences

Cognitive VR sessions are adaptable for one-on-one therapy or group engagement. Residents can share experiences, reminisce together, and strengthen connections within their community.

Cognitive Exercises and Games

Interactive games and puzzles are tailored to stimulate memory, attention, and critical thinking. These exercises encourage active participation while keeping sessions enjoyable and rewarding.
